I'd like to install solar window film on a west side window to reduce heating in that room. It's a double hung single pane window with a storm window. About a 3" gap. I could put it on the regular window or the storm window. I was thinking storm window. Pros or Cons of either installation? Thanks.

Check window warranty to make sure that you do not void warranty with window film. Also discuss this problem with the window film manufacturer. Awnings, solar shades, blinds, insulated window treatments, and other options are available.

I'm thinking of a similar installation, but I've heard that solar film can cause some windows to crack due to increased heat. What did you learn? Did you install the film?
